Longitudinal Changes and Interobserver Variability of Systolic Myocardial Deformation Values in a Prospective Cohort of Healthy Fetuses across Gestation and after Delivery.

Abstract

BACKGROUND

Normative data for fetal myocardial deformation values have not been comprehensively described in a longitudinal cohort. The effect of gestational age on these values and on interobserver variability require further investigation.

METHODS

Sixty gravid women were prospectively enrolled before 20 weeks' gestation. The following measures were obtained by two blinded observers at five time points across gestation and also at 4 to 8 weeks' postnatal age: global circumferential strain and strain rate, global longitudinal left ventricular strain and strain rate, global longitudinal right ventricular strain and strain rate, and left and right ventricular myocardial performance indices. Optimal myocardial visualization and frame rate (≥100 frames/sec) were ensured.

RESULTS

For gestational age groups ≥24 weeks, intraclass correlation coefficients between observers were >0.70 for all measures and >0.85 for the majority of measures of myocardial deformation. At 20 to 21 weeks' gestation, intraclass correlation coefficients were 0.35 to 0.52 for longitudinal measures and 0.74 to 0.82 for circumferential measures. Myocardial performance index intraclass correlation coefficients were <0.80 at all time points and <0.70 for most time points. Global longitudinal left ventricular strain and global circumferential strain values remained stable across gestational age groups. Global longitudinal right ventricular strain values remained stable across gestation and increased after birth. Global circumferential strain rate, global longitudinal left ventricular strain rate, and global longitudinal right ventricular strain rate decreased from 20 to 21 weeks' gestation to the remainder of gestation and then remained stable until delivery. Upon delivery, global circumferential strain rate and global longitudinal left ventricular strain rate decreased, and global longitudinal right ventricular strain rate increased.

CONCLUSIONS

Interobserver variability of fetal strain and strain rate measured at ≥24 weeks' gestation was lower in comparison with values obtained at 20 to 21 weeks' gestation and lower in comparison with left ventricular and right ventricular myocardial performance indices using the described protocol. Gestational changes in fetal myocardial deformation values likely reflect changes in preload and/or afterload on the fetal heart.

摘要

背景

胎儿心肌变形值的标准数据在纵向队列研究中尚未得到全面描述。胎龄对这些值以及观察者间变异性的影响需要进一步研究。

方法

前瞻性纳入60例妊娠20周前的孕妇。由两名不知情的观察者在孕期的五个时间点以及出生后4至8周时获取以下测量值:整体圆周应变和应变率、左心室整体纵向应变和应变率、右心室整体纵向应变和应变率,以及左右心室心肌性能指标。确保实现最佳心肌可视化和帧率(≥100帧/秒)。

结果

对于胎龄≥24周的组,观察者间的组内相关系数对于所有测量值均>0.70,对于大多数心肌变形测量值>0.85。在妊娠20至21周时,纵向测量值的组内相关系数为0.35至0.52,圆周测量值的组内相关系数为0.74至0.82。心肌性能指标的组内相关系数在所有时间点均<0.80,大多数时间点<0.70。左心室整体纵向应变和整体圆周应变值在各胎龄组中保持稳定。右心室整体纵向应变值在整个孕期保持稳定,并在出生后增加。整体圆周应变率、左心室整体纵向应变率和右心室整体纵向应变率从妊娠20至21周降至孕期其余时间,并在分娩前保持稳定。分娩时,整体圆周应变率和左心室整体纵向应变率降低,右心室整体纵向应变率增加。

结论

与妊娠20至21周时获得的值相比,妊娠≥24周时测量的胎儿应变和应变率的观察者间变异性较低,并且与使用所述方案测量的左心室和右心室心肌性能指标相比也较低。胎儿心肌变形值的孕期变化可能反映了胎儿心脏前负荷和/或后负荷的变化。
